The headlining show in Redding was on the 23rd at the Cascade Theater and the opening bands were Brighten and Wesley Jensen. Wes also opened for the entire length of the acoustic tour (accompanied by Christie DuPree, of course). Away Station and Verbatym opened the Vegas headline show.
